Sibford Ferris has a small, safe play area for children aged <12years, which has been funded and maintained through the Parish Council, various grants and fundraising efforts over the past 22 years. The play area is regularly used by local children, however the existing timber play equipment is suffering from timber rot and needs replacing. We are raising funds to go towards covering the cost of the designing and installing new equipment and replacing the existing perimeter fence. Our vision is to provide a modern, vibrant and safe play area for our children, with seating areas for adults. We would like to ask for contributions towards the cost of individual pieces of equipment that we have selected after listening to the views of local children, parents and carers.

Local children love to use the Play Area and have been using it for the past 22 years. With the existing equipment in decline, we want to be able to continue providing a safe area for young children from The Sibfords and nearby villages. We have listened to the views of local children, parents and carers about what they want for the play area and have taken this into consideration with the design.
